NYC LANDLORDS NEED $1B TO AVOID DEFAULTS The New York Housing Conference warned that affordable housing landlords in New York City need about $1 billion from the mayor to avoid widespread defaults. It said tens of thousands of the city’s roughly 213,000 subsidized, rent‑stabilized units are losing money after pandemic rent losses and utility increases. The group said a multi-year rent freeze proposed by M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ani could deepen the crisis unless paired with relief for landlords. Full article: msn.com/en-us/money/re…
